✨Finished Product✨
After a lot of trial and error (and my machine basically eating my last attempt after it temporarily broke) my first proper scratch sleeve bolero is done.
This really has been a long process, I drafted the pattern myself, made a few test ones out of cheaper fabric, made a lot of alterations to the pattern, then I got the fabric I wanted to use, followed by the great machine malfunction, and then even this particular bolero was such a time consuming process...
I think in total it took about 9+ hours.
The fabric is organic cotton on the outside and ice silk on the inside and for the mittens.
The part that makes it so time consuming is needing to be so slow and careful when seeing the fabric together in order to avoid bunching since the two different fabric has such different levels of stretch.
But as hard as it’s been I’m so proud of this in particular.
It’s something that will actually impact my sons wellbeing, childhood ezcema, especially in such a young child who can not stop them self from scratching, is such a hard thing to cope with.
These sleeves make it a little bit better.
(He is still able to hold and pick things up while wearing these sleeves)
I think for my next one I may make it a little bit bigger, but other than that I think the pattern is pretty much set.
